Recording
The available flash range
Shutter speed for each flash setting
¢1 It may vary depending on the [Min. Shtr Speed] setting.
¢2 When [Min. Shtr Speed] is set to [AUTO].
¢2: The shutter speed becomes a maximum of 1 second in the following cases:
When the Optical Image Stabilizer is set to [OFF].
When the camera has determined that there is very little jitter when the Optical Image
Stabilizer is set to [ON].
In Intelligent Auto Mode, shutter speed changes depending on the identified scene.
The shutter speed for [Sports], [Snow], [Beach & Snorkeling] and Scene Modes will be different
from above table.
Note
If you bring the flash too close to an object, the object may be distorted or discoloured by the
heat or lighting from the flash.
When you take a picture beyond the available flash range, the exposure may not be adjusted
properly and the picture may become bright or dark.
When the flash is being charged, the flash icon blinks red, and you cannot take a picture even
when you press the shutter button fully.
When you take a picture beyond the available flash range, the White Balance may not be
properly adjusted.
The flash effect may not be sufficient when using [Flash Burst] in Scene Mode or when shutter
speed is fast.
It may take time to charge the flash if you are taking pictures in quick succession. Take a
picture after the access indication disappears.
The Red-Eye Reduction effect differs between people. Also, if the subject is far away from the
camera or was not looking at the first flash, the effect may not be as evident.

Panasonic Lumix DMC-FT3 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Camera typeCompact camera
Sensor typeCCD
Image stabilizerYes
Image sensor size1/2.33 \
Image formats supportedJPG
Supported aspect ratios3:2, 4:3, 16:9
Maximum image resolution4000 x 3000 pixels
Still image resolution(s)480 x 480, 640 x 360, 640 x 424, 640 x 480, 1280 x 720, 1536 x 1536, 1600 x 1200, 1920 x 1080, 1920 x 1920, 2048 x 1360, 2448 x 2448, 2560 x 1440, 2560 x 1712, 2560 x 1920, 2992 x 2992, 3264 x 1840, 3264 x 2176, 3264 x 2448, 4000 x 2240, 4000 x 2248, 4000 x 2672, 4000 x 3000
Digital zoom4 x
Optical zoom4.6 x
Combined zoom18.4 x
Extra/Smart zoom6 x
Focal length range4.9 - 22.8 mm
Maximum aperture number5.9
Minimum aperture number3.3
Number of aspheric elements5
Lens structure (elements/groups)10/8
Maximum focal length (35mm film equiv)128 mm
Minimum focal length (35mm film equiv)28 mm
Focus adjustmentAuto
Auto focusing (AF) modesContinuous Auto Focus
Macro focusing range (tele)0.3 m
ISO sensitivity100, 200, 400, 800, 1600, 3200, 6400, Auto
Light exposure controlProgram AE
Light exposure correction± 2EV (1/3EV step)
Camera shutter typeElectronic
Camera shutter interval0.3 s
Fastest camera shutter speed1/1300 s
Slowest camera shutter speed8 s
Flash modesAuto, Forced off, Forced on, Red-eye reduction, Slow synchronization
Flash range (tele)0.3 - 3.1 m
Flash range (wide)0.3 - 5.6 m
Power source typeBattery
Scene modesCandlelight, Children, Close-up (macro), Fireworks, Night landscape, Night portrait, Party (indoor), Portrait, Self-portrait, Snow, Sports, Sunset, Landscape (scenery)
Photo effectsBlack&White, Sepia, Skin tones, Vivid
White balanceAuto, Cloudy, Daylight, Incandescent, Shade
Camera playbackMovie, Single image, Slide show, Thumbnails
Self-timer delay2, 10 s
Camera file systemDCF 2.0, DPOF 1.1, Exif 2.3
On Screen Display (OSD) languagesDEU, ENG, FRE, ITA, JPN
Video resolutions320 x 240, 640 x 480, 1920 x 1080 pixels
Motion JPEG frame rate30 fps
Video formats supportedAVCHD, M-JPEG, Quicktime
Maximum video resolution1920 x 1080 pixels
Analog signal format systemPAL
Internal memory19 MB
Compatible memory cardsSD, SDHC, SDXC
Field of view100 %
Display diagonal2.7 \
Display resolution (numeric)230000 pixels
USB version2.0
Product colorOrange
Waterproof up to12 m
Freezeproof up to-10 °C
Battery voltage3.6 V
Battery capacity940 mAh
Battery life (CIPA standard)310 shots
Cables includedAC, AV, USB
Bundled softwarePHOTOfunSTUDIO 6.1 QuickTime Adobe Reader Super LoiLoScope
Weight and Dimensions IconWeight and Dimensions
Depth26.5 mm
Width103.5 mm
Height64 mm
Weight175 g
Weight (including battery)197 g
